111. Author: Fairouz Lamtai Title: The Role of Arab Satellite Channels in Developing Political Awareness of Arab Revolutions: Al Jazeera as an Example Publisher: Usama Publishing and Distribution House, Jordan Year: 2020 Language: Arabic

Description: in recent years, t he Arab world experienced events that changed its reality and brought down regimes that ruled for decades. Arab satellite channels, such as Al Jazeera, played a major role in these events. Through its news coverage and political talk shows, the channel helped raise the level of political awareness of Arab citizens and empower them to change their reality. The Arab Spring would not have been possible without the role of the media, which paved the way for change years ago, creating a political culture and political awareness critical to the existing reality. Al Jazeera in particular, played a leading role in the Arab uprisings through its extensive coverage in which it managed to engage and mobilize large sections of Arab publics. 112. Author: Kemal Yildirim

Title: Qatar - Public Diplomacy and the Media Publisher: Lambert Academic Publishing, Germany Year: 2020 Language: English, German, Italian, French, Portuguese, Dutch

Description: In 2003, Qatar adopted a constitution that provided for the direct election of 30 of the 45 members of the Legislative Council. The constitution was overwhelmingly approved in a referendum, with almost 98% in favor. The Emir has exclusive powers to appoint and remove the prime minister and cabinet ministers who, together, constitute the Council of Ministers, which is the supreme executive authority in the country. The Qatari diplomacy has been very active and managed to mediate in various crises in the region over the last few decades. A number of tools, including the media, is employed strategically to supports Qatar’s diplomacy. Since its launch in 1996, Al Jazeera established itself as a regional and global media player influencing both media and the politics.
